环形斑光束在非线性克尔介质中的自聚焦效应

摘    要:通过数值求解非线性Schrödinger方程,详细讨论了环形斑光束在非线性克尔介质中的传输特性.当入射光超过一定的功率时,光束产生多级自聚焦现象,自聚焦焦点出现在离轴的环上;自聚焦阈值与环形光束的半径有关;传输过程中光斑存在横向分裂现象,并且分裂与聚焦交替进行;当两个半径不同的同轴环状光束同时在非线性介质中传输时产生耦合效应,耦合效应使其自聚焦增强.

关 键 词:环形斑激光束  克尔介质  非线性传输  自聚焦

Self-Focusing Effect of Circle Spot Laser Beam in Kerr-medium

Abstract:The transmission of circle spot laser beam in Kerr-medium is investigated with solving nonlinear Schrdinger equation numerically. The spot splitting and splitting variation are observed in the transmission process if the laser beam power is above a certain value. The critical power is related with the radius of the circle spot laser beam. It is also discovered the coupling between the double coaxial circles laser beams if they pass through Kerr-medium.
Keywords:Circle spot laser beam  Kerr-medium  Nonlinear transmission  Self-focusing
